Output 21f06d9e2ffa523b63ebdbc1dfc42d8d7729f4945405803c2133b53566ce2019:1

value
6982394609524
script pubkey
OP_0 OP_PUSHBYTES_20 32ebb984252f4e9b0022e74a4b04f8fa5786cad8
address
tb1qxt4mnpp99a8fkqpzua9ykp8clftcdjkcfsm7k0
transaction
21f06d9e2ffa523b63ebdbc1dfc42d8d7729f4945405803c2133b53566ce2019
confirmations
185047
spent
true